Swift, ISDA Prep FpML Messaging Pilot

NEW YORK—The Society for Worldwide Interbank Financial Telecommunication (Swift) and the International Swaps and Derivatives Association (ISDA) expect to see the first messages based on ISDA's XML-based Financial products Markup Language (FpML) transmitted over Swift's IP-based SwiftNet network in the next few weeks, DWT has learned.
